In the 1901 census, a 72 year old man named John Rawnsley is living with Jonas and his family, who is recorded as being Jonas' uncle.[2]I suspect that John Rawnsley is a misspelling of John Rangley". That would explain the relationship between them.
Jonas and Sarah also had an adopted son named Harold Priestly, who was born around 1887.[2]
